# IT4Innovations 2020
easyblock = 'CmdCp'
name = 'LAMMPS'
version = '20200505'
homepage = 'http://lammps.sandia.gov'
description = """LAMMPS is a classical molecular dynamics code,
and an acronym for Large-scale Atomic/Molecular Massively Parallel Simulator.
Has potentials for solid-state materials (metals, semiconductors) and soft
matter (biomolecules, polymers) and coarse-grained or mesoscopic systems.
It can be used to model atoms or, more generically, as a parallel particle simulator at the atomic,
meso, or continuum scale.
"""
toolchain = {'name': 'intel', 'version': '2020a'}
source_urls = ['https://github.com/lammps/lammps/archive']
sources = ['patch_5May2020.tar.gz']
dependencies = [
('tbb', '2020.1'),
('gperftools', '2.8'),
]
builddependencies = [
('CMake', '3.16.4'),
]
# deprecated MEAM, REAX
local_commands = "cd src && "
local_commands += "make yes-kokkos && make yes-user-meamc && "
local_commands += "make yes-user-phonon && make yes-misc && "
local_commands += "make yes-kspace && make yes-manybody && make yes-molecule && "
local_commands += "make yes-qeq && make yes-rigid && make yes-user-misc && "
local_commands += "make yes-user-reaxc && make yes-user-omp && "
local_commands += "make yes-spin && make yes-user-diffraction && "
local_commands += "make -j 16 intel_cpu_intelmpi && mv lmp_intel_cpu_intelmpi lammps"
cmds_map = [('.*', local_commands)]
files_to_copy = [
(['src/lammps'], 'bin'),
]
sanity_check_paths = {
'files': ['bin/lammps'],
'dirs': [''],
}
moduleclass = 'chem'
